What to Do When You Have Finished Using Your iMac G5
When you have finished working with your iMac G5, you have two options.
Put Your iMac G5 to Sleep to Save Energy
If you will be away from your iMac G5 for less than a few days, put the computer to
sleep. When the computer is in sleep, its screen is dark and a small white light below
the lower-right corner of the display pulsates. You can quickly wake the computer and
bypass the startup process.

Shut Down Your iMac G5
If you will not use your iMac G5 for more than a few days, shut it down.
m
Choose Apple (
K
) > Shut Down.

Warning:
Shut down your iMac G5 before moving it. Moving your computer while
the hard disk is spinning can damage the hard disk, causing loss of data or the
inability to start up from the hard disk.
